// Broker upgrade notes for plugin authors:
// Quillbus 4.x replaces the legacy 3.x wire protocol. Plugins must
// construct the client with explicit protocol negotiation enabled,
// or connections to the Larkfield cluster will be silently downgraded
// and dropped after 30s. Topic names are unchanged. For local testing
// against the sandbox broker, authenticate with the key below.

API key for bafof-bagaf: qvz2-qi

Hey, welcome to the Pendle support rotation! You've probably heard about the cron drift saga: jobs on the Tallowfield cluster fire a few minutes late, and it gets worse after each reboot. We suspect the NTP sidecar, but the ClockWarden team is still digging. Meanwhile, customers will ask why reports are late — point them at the status page. To pull drift metrics yourself, call the ChronoTrace API with the key below.

gateway credential: kto3_qfe

Handover — Vexler partner SFTP drop

Ownership moves to you today. Drop runs hourly from Vexler's end into the intake bucket via the relay host. Watch for zero-byte files; their exporter flakes on Mondays. Creds live in the ops vault, path noted in the runbook. Vault auto-seals after 48h idle. Support escalations go to the on-call rotation, not me. If the vault is sealed when you need it, unseal with the recovery passphrase below.

recovery phrase for tadug-fafof: zorwyn-kasion

Handover: Brockline build → hermetic migration

To: Vessa. From: Orin.

Moved core targets to the Stonebed hermetic toolchain. Plugin authors: no network fetches at build time anymore; declare all deps in the manifest. Sandbox breaks if you shell out to system compilers — use the pinned toolchain. Remaining: docs site and two legacy codegen plugins. Signing vault for the plugin registry is sealed pending handover; the recovery passphrase follows.

vault phrase of kafog-kahif = holdor-rusir-praox